opetat. out of business. I le withdre his application to renew E two-vehicle licence becau there was "too much hassle'.

John I lulme, trading Winsford Skip I lire, want( to renew his national licen for one vehicle in .possessit and one vehicle to be a quired, based at Elm Cottag Chester Lane, Winsford.

But the county council o jected on the grounds that ti operating centre was unsu. able for the purpose. T county had also talc( planning enforcement actic over the use of Hulme premises and an appe against that action w. dismissed.

Hulme's renewal applic don was listed for hearh before North Western Depu Licensing Authority Ron L vin at Chester and the coun appeared to pursue its obje (ions.

But Hulme withdrew F application before the heal-it was due to start because I had decided to sell the bin ness.
